Others, especially some firearms, are powerful enough to kill a player with a single hit. Some Weapons are fairly weak and will take a small amount of Health per hit. Although a splint is not required (or not usable, in later versions) for a sprain, it will decrease the time required to heal a sprained leg and will also help protect against breaking the leg.Ī Hay Bale, an area of at least two blocks deep water or a pile of zombie remains, will break the fall and prevent damage from any height.Īll Weapons can inflict damage, with varying levels delivered depending upon the Weapon used, the quality of the weapon, what kind of ammo, and various skill levels of the player using the weapon. Leg injuries reduce movement speed and may require the use of a Splint. There is also the possibility of a ( Sprained Leg or Broken Leg) incurred during the landing. Falling from a great height will result in a high loss of Health or even death. Fall Damage įalling from a height will deplete a player's Health with the amount lost proportionately to the height of the fall. See also List of Zombies and List of buffs. These can vary from being Stunned, Bleeding, and/or Infection, with the latter two capable of killing a player if not treated. The types of damaged received are as follows: Health and Max Health can be restored by consuming certain Food items or by using Medical supplies such as Painkillers.Ī player can lose Health by receiving damage from hits by Zombies or other players, falling from heights, splash damage from explosions, drowning, and falling blocks. Eating or drinking the wrong thing, such as Raw Meat or Bottled Murky Water can result in Dysentery, which can also reduce a player's health to zero, resulting in death. For example, failing to drink or eat will result in thirst and hunger, which if left unchecked, will eventually result in losing Health and ultimately in death. Reaching a Health of zero results in Death.Ī player must actively maintain his Health through the use of Food and Medical Supplies. Max Health is limited by the Max Health Cap. The maximum Health is determined by the Max Health of the player. A player's current health status is represented by a red horizontal bar at the bottom-left corner of the player's screen. Health is one of the main Player Statistics.
